    Sujet

    Meckel syndrome (MKS) is an embryonic lethal, autosomal recessive disorder characterized by polycystic kidney disease, central nervous system defects, polydactyly and liver fibrosis. B9D1 is a B9 domain-containing protein, one of several that are involved in ciliogenesis. Alterations in expression of this gene have been found in a family with Meckel syndrome. B9D1, and its related protein B9D2, form a complex with MKS1, disruption of which causes MKS. B9D1 is thought to be required for normal hedgehog signaling, ciliogenesis, and ciliary protein localization .Synonyms: B9 domain-containing protein 1, EPPB9
